Attending an exam is not just simply going to the exam hall, answering the questions and returning back. There are so many lessons to be learnt. It is like a life within a life.
When you sit for an exam, you need a preparation. Likewise everything in life requires preparation.
In an exam, you can’t just sit down and keep writing whatever comes up. You have a time limit. You’ve to finish. Likewise everything in life has to be done within the time available for it.
You need set short term goals in both life and exam. You can’t simply plan to complete your exam within three or four hours of allocated time. If this turns out to be your case, then its quite common for you to answer whole bunch of questions (in extreme cases this can account for even 40% of your answers) in last half an hour. Similarly you can’t simply plan to be like Albert Einstein (I prefer to write the name of Linus Pauling instead, but I think most of my readers don’t know much about him) or Adam Smith without having any intermediate goals. The only thing different between life and exam with this regard is you know when your exam will end, but you have no idea about your lifespan.
A good exam requires careful planning. Sometimes things go great even without plan. But remember, that’s the exception proving the rule. Similarly your life also needs a plan. Without plan, you may do great in one step, but overall, unless you’re quite a lucky person, things are bound to be worse.
Answering question and getting mark requires a balance. You can’t go for the best answer in one question and write down others in jumble. Correspondingly in your life, you can’t exchange all the goods for one single best step. A balance should be kept everywhere.
In an exam hall, even if you’ve everything planned, things might go awry. And the most important thing is to tackle the situation. In life, there will be millions of times when things will go desperately wrong… all you need is face it.
No matter whether things are going good or bad, an exam is bound to end. No matter how much light blaze your day, no matter how much darkness masks your morning, it is going to end… today… tomorrow… or the day after tomorrow.
Life has its problems… it has things to cheer as well… so just…
go through it.
